The Allure of Mount Gay: Barbados’ Liquid History

Mount Gay isn’t just a rum brand; it’s a piece of Barbadian history. Claiming the title of the world’s oldest rum distillery, with records dating back to 1703, Mount Gay embodies the island’s spirit and sugarcane heritage. Understanding this rich history is crucial to appreciating the nuances of the blending experience. The distillery, nestled in the northern parish of St. Lucy, isn’t just a production facility; it’s a living museum connecting you to centuries of rum-making tradition. Getting There: Your Journey to Rum Heaven

Reaching the Mount Gay Distillery can be an adventure in itself, depending on where you’re staying in Barbados. Here are a few options:

  • Rental Car: Renting a car offers the most flexibility, allowing you to explore the island at your own pace. The distillery is well-signposted, and the drive itself is scenic. Be mindful of driving on the left! A GPS is highly recommended.
  • Taxi: Taxis are readily available throughout Barbados, especially in tourist areas. Agree on a fare beforehand, as meters aren’t always used. This is a comfortable (albeit pricier) option.
  • Bus: The public bus system in Barbados is affordable but can be a bit chaotic. Look for buses headed north to St. Lucy. This is the most budget-friendly option but requires patience and willingness to navigate local routes.
  • Organized Tour: Many tour operators offer excursions that include the Mount Gay Distillery. This is a hassle-free option that often combines the rum blending experience with other attractions.

Practical Tip: If you’re driving, be prepared for narrow roads and the occasional wandering animal. Give yourself ample time to get there, especially if you’re not familiar with the area.

The Rum Education: A Crash Course in Caribbean Spirits

Before you start blending, you’ll receive a thorough rum education. This includes learning about:

  • Sugarcane Harvest: The entire process begins with the sugarcane harvest. Discover the importance of the right varieties of sugarcane and how the terroir (soil and climate) influences the final product.
  • Fermentation: You’ll learn how sugarcane juice or molasses is fermented to create a “wash,” the base for rum production. The length of fermentation and the type of yeast used significantly impact the flavor profile.
  • Distillation: Find out about the different distillation methods used at Mount Gay, including both column and pot stills. Each method produces a uniquely flavored rum. Column stills create lighter-bodied rums, while pot stills yield richer, more complex flavors.
  • Aging: Arguably the most crucial step, aging rum in oak barrels imparts color, flavor, and aroma. You’ll discover how the type of oak, previous use of the barrel (e.g., bourbon barrels), and length of aging influence the final product. The Caribbean climate accelerates the aging process compared to cooler regions.

The Blending Masterclass: Unleash Your Inner Mixologist

This is the heart of the experience! You’ll be provided with a selection of different Mount Gay rums, each with distinct characteristics. These might include:

  • White Rum: Unaged or lightly aged, offering a clean and crisp base.
  • Aged Rum (varying ages): Rums aged for different periods, providing notes of vanilla, caramel, spice, and oak. This is where you explore the complexity and depth that aging brings to the rum.
  • Pot Still Rum: A richer, more flavorful rum with a distinct character. This might be used to add boldness and depth to your blend.

You’ll receive guidance on how to combine these rums to achieve your desired flavor profile. Factors to consider include:

  • Balance: Aim for a balanced blend, where no single flavor overpowers the others.
  • Complexity: Strive for a blend with layers of flavor that evolve on the palate.
  • Aroma: Consider the aroma of your blend – it should be inviting and reflective of the flavors within.
  • Personal Preference: Ultimately, your goal is to create a rum that you enjoy!

Blending Tools and Techniques: Your Rum Lab Essentials

You’ll be equipped with the necessary tools, including beakers, pipettes, and measuring glasses. The Mount Gay experts will demonstrate proper techniques for measuring and mixing the rums.

Practical Example: Creating a Spiced Rum Blend

Let’s say you want to create a spiced rum blend. Here’s a possible approach:

  1. Start with a Base: Use a lightly aged rum (e.g., Mount Gay Eclipse) as the foundation, providing a smooth and approachable base (approx. 60% of the blend).
  2. Add Depth and Spice: Introduce a small amount of pot still rum (e.g., a small proportion of Mount Gay Black Barrel) to add richness and spice notes like cinnamon and clove (approx. 20% of the blend).
  3. Enhance the Sweetness: Incorporate a slightly older rum (e.g., a small addition of Mount Gay XO) for notes of vanilla and caramel, adding a touch of sweetness (approx. 20% of the blend).
  4. Adjust and Refine: Sample your blend and make adjustments as needed. Add a few drops of pot still rum if you want more spice, or a bit more aged rum for added sweetness and complexity. This is where your own palate guides the process.

Important: Every palate is different! Don’t be afraid to experiment and create a blend that truly reflects your tastes.

The Cost and Booking: Planning Your Experience

The cost of the Mount Gay Rum Blending Experience typically ranges from $100 to $150 USD per person, but it’s subject to changes. It is advisable to check their website or contact them directly for most accurate pricing figures. The price usually includes the rum education, the blending masterclass, the bottling of your custom blend, and a tour of the distillery.

Booking in Advance: Essential for a Smooth Experience

Due to the popularity of the blending experience, it’s highly recommended to book in advance, especially during peak season. You can book online through the Mount Gay website or through tour operators. Booking ahead ensures that you secure your spot and avoid disappointment.

Beyond Mount Gay: Other Rum Experiences in Barbados

While the Mount Gay Rum Blending Experience is exceptional, Barbados offers other rum-related attractions worth exploring. Consider visiting:

  • St. Nicholas Abbey: A historic plantation great house with a working rum distillery. Experience a different perspective on rum production and enjoy the beautiful surroundings.
  • Foursquare Rum Distillery: A modern distillery producing award-winning rums. Take a tour to learn about their innovative approach to rum making.
  • Rum Shops: Scattered throughout the island, rum shops are local institutions where you can experience the authentic Barbadian rum culture.
